In June 2023, two trade union leaders - Thidar Win and Hlaing Win Htet - at Sun Apparel garment factory, supplier of JAKO Sports Clothing in Yangon’s Hlaing Tharyar Township in Myanmar, were arrested after they demanded a pay increase and better working conditions. Since their arrest they have been held by the military. As a result of the strike JAKO confirmed that the daily wage was increased to 5,600 MMK and the attendance bonuses to 20,000 MMK. Furthermore, JAKO emphasized that they will try to get the two labour union activists released as soon as possible.
